LOOP TELECOM AND TRADING LIMITED vs UNION OF INDIA

Citation / case number
SC 2015/41354
Court
Supreme Court of India
Petitioner
LOOP TELECOM AND TRADING LIMITED
Respondent
UNION OF INDIA
Author
HON'BLE THE CHIEF JUSTICE
Bench
HON'BLE THE CHIEF JUSTICE, HON'BLE MR. JUSTICE SURYA KANT, HON'BLE MR. JUSTICE VIKRAM NATH

Judgment text excerpt

The Supreme Court addressed appeals concerning the refund of Entry Fees paid for 2G licenses, which were quashed in a prior judgment. The appellant, Loop Telecom, sought a refund of Rs 1454.94 crores based on the quashing of the licenses. The court examined the jurisdiction of the Telecom Disputes Settlement and Appellate Tribunal and the principles of frustration and restitution in the context of the claim.
